What is novaPDF?
novaPDF enables the generation of PDF files from virtually any document that can be printed. This encompasses a variety of formats such as emails, Microsoft Office files, web pages, and text documents. Functioning as a printer driver, it allows users to print directly from any Windows application that has printing capabilities. By designating novaPDF Pro as your default printer, your selected document is transformed and saved as a PDF file effortlessly. Furthermore, users have the ability to tailor various settings including resolution, security options, profiles, bookmarks, and compression for text and images, ensuring a personalized experience with every conversion. This flexibility makes novaPDF a versatile tool for anyone needing reliable PDF creation.
What is PDFKit?
PDFKit is a highly adaptable library that enables the generation of PDF documents seamlessly in both Node and browser environments, allowing for the effortless creation of complex, multi-page, printable documents. Its user-friendly API supports chainable functions and offers both low-level capabilities and higher-level abstractions, streamlining the document creation process. With just a few function calls, users can craft sophisticated documents quickly and efficiently. The library also incorporates a range of access permissions, granting options for printing, copying, modifying, annotating, filling forms, ensuring content accessibility, and assembling documents. Accessibility is a priority, as the tool supports features such as marked content, a coherent structure, Tagged PDF, and compliance with PDF/UA standards. Furthermore, PDFKit is designed to work seamlessly with JPEG and PNG images, including support for indexed PNGs and those with transparency. In addition to utilizing PDFKit, it is essential to have a destination for streaming the generated output. For projects that employ PDFKit via Browserify, installing the brfs module through npm is a necessary step for loading built-in font data into the library. The robust combination of these features positions PDFKit as an invaluable resource for anyone seeking to produce detailed and professional-quality PDF documents with remarkable efficiency, making it a top choice for developers and designers alike.
What is PDFBox?
The Apache PDFBox® library is a dynamic open-source solution in Java designed for handling PDF documents effectively. This project not only allows users to create new PDFs but also to modify existing ones and extract various types of content from those files. In addition, Apache PDFBox includes numerous command-line utilities that expand its capabilities even further. Distributed under the Apache License v2.0, the library provides functions for extracting Unicode text from PDFs, splitting a single PDF into several files, and merging multiple PDFs into one cohesive document. Users can also extract data from forms, fill out PDF forms, and ensure that their files meet the PDF/A-1b validation standard. The ability to print PDFs using the standard Java printing API, as well as to create new PDFs that incorporate embedded fonts and images, is also part of its robust feature set. Moreover, users can save PDFs as image files in formats such as PNG or JPEG, which adds to its versatility. The library further allows for the digital signing of PDF documents, thereby enhancing their authenticity and security. Lastly, it is crucial for users to examine the export control information related to the encryption features offered by Apache PDFBox to ensure adherence to applicable regulations, making it a comprehensive tool for PDF management.
What is KDAN PDF?
KDAN PDF is a versatile and intelligent PDF solution designed to optimize the digital workflows of independent professionals and specialized industries. In a world where document management is central to success, KDAN PDF provides the tools necessary to edit, secure, and analyze files with precision across Windows, Mac, and mobile devices.
The platform stands out by integrating document intelligence that allows professionals to interact with their PDF content. Through the AI assistant, users can generate summaries of lengthy reports, ask specific questions about file data, and extract tables directly into editable spreadsheets. This intelligent approach minimizes administrative overhead and allows users to focus on high-value tasks.
Key features of KDAN PDF include:
- Professional Editing and OCR: Seamlessly update text and images or use multi-language OCR to digitize paper archives.
- Synchronized Workflow: Maintain continuity across iOS, Android, and desktop environments with a unified user interface.
- Advanced Security: Protect sensitive information with permanent redaction, encryption, and digital signatures.
- Flexible Organization: Manage documents efficiently using Bates numbering, page rearrangement, and high-fidelity file conversion.
Optimized for fields like healthcare, legal services, and academia, KDAN PDF ensures that your professional documentation is handled with the highest level of integrity and efficiency. By providing an offline-first experience, it guarantees that your most sensitive data remains secure while you work across any screen.
